Bombers prep game plan for two quarterbacks when they meet Montreal

WINNIPEG – With Buck Pierce’s status still uncertain, the Winnipeg Blue Bombers are preparing a game plan without knowing who their starting pivot will be Monday in Montreal.

Pierce has a mild concussion but could be cleared to play.

If he doesn’t, Joey Elliott will take the snaps and both men were on the field for practice Wednesday.

Offensive co-ordinator Gary Crowton says he’s preparing game plans for both but he’s hoping Pierce is ready to play.

Pierce has said he feels fine but he has to pass a test before he’s allowed to return.

He was injured by a helmet to the chin in Saturday’s 29-10 loss to the Toronto Argonauts.
